What is this biking experience about?

It’s a scenic one-day mountain biking adventure through the Sacred Valley, exploring the Inca sites of Moray and the salt mines of Maras. The ride combines culture, history, and stunning Andean landscapes.

Where does the tour start and end?

The trip usually starts from Cusco with private transport to the starting point near Chinchero. It ends in the Sacred Valley or back in Cusco, depending on the operator.

How long is the ride?

The ride typically lasts 4–5 hours, covering approximately 30 km (18 miles), mostly downhill or rolling terrain with some short climbs.

What’s the difficulty level?

Moderate. It’s suitable for active travelers with basic biking experience. The terrain is mostly wide dirt roads and some singletrack, with vehicle support nearby.

What altitude is it at?

The ride begins around 3,700 meters (12,100 ft) and descends gradually to around 2,900 meters (9,500 ft), so acclimatization in Cusco prior to the
ride is important.
